public enum DateFormat extends Enum<DateFormat>
DateTimeFormatter
produces the
same values as the Elasticsearch formatter.Modifier and Type | Method and Description |
---|---|
String |
getPattern() |
static DateFormat |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static DateFormat[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
@Deprecated public static final DateFormat none
format = {}
to disable built-in date
formats in the @Field annotation.@Deprecated public static final DateFormat custom
format
property to empty {}
.public static final DateFormat basic_date
public static final DateFormat basic_date_time
public static final DateFormat basic_date_time_no_millis
public static final DateFormat basic_ordinal_date
public static final DateFormat basic_ordinal_date_time
public static final DateFormat basic_ordinal_date_time_no_millis
public static final DateFormat basic_time
public static final DateFormat basic_time_no_millis
public static final DateFormat basic_t_time
public static final DateFormat basic_t_time_no_millis
public static final DateFormat basic_week_date
public static final DateFormat basic_week_date_time
public static final DateFormat basic_week_date_time_no_millis
public static final DateFormat date
public static final DateFormat date_hour
public static final DateFormat date_hour_minute
public static final DateFormat date_hour_minute_second
public static final DateFormat date_hour_minute_second_fraction
public static final DateFormat date_hour_minute_second_millis
public static final DateFormat date_optional_time
public static final DateFormat date_time
public static final DateFormat date_time_no_millis
public static final DateFormat epoch_millis
public static final DateFormat epoch_second
public static final DateFormat hour
public static final DateFormat hour_minute
public static final DateFormat hour_minute_second
public static final DateFormat hour_minute_second_fraction
public static final DateFormat hour_minute_second_millis
public static final DateFormat ordinal_date
public static final DateFormat ordinal_date_time
public static final DateFormat ordinal_date_time_no_millis
public static final DateFormat time
public static final DateFormat time_no_millis
public static final DateFormat t_time
public static final DateFormat t_time_no_millis
public static final DateFormat week_date
public static final DateFormat week_date_time
public static final DateFormat week_date_time_no_millis
public static final DateFormat weekyear
public static final DateFormat weekyear_week
public static final DateFormat weekyear_week_day
public static final DateFormat year
public static final DateFormat year_month
public static final DateFormat year_month_day
public static DateFormat[] values()
for (DateFormat c : DateFormat.values()) System.out.println(c);
public static DateFormat valueOf(String name)
name
- the name of the enum constant to be returned.I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is nullpublic String getPattern()
Copyright © 2011–2021 Pivotal Software, Inc.. All rights reserved.